智能诊断技术在新能源汽车检测与维修中的应用 被引量:2

Application of Intelligent Diagnosis Technology in the Inspection and Maintenance of New Energy Vehicles

摘要 随着新能源汽车的普及,传统检测与维修方式已无法满足其复杂电气系统和高集成化电子控制装置的需求。智能诊断技术通过人工智能、大数据和物联网技术的应用,提供更精准的故障预测和实时监控,显著提升检测与维修的效率和准确性。本文通过数据共享和协同发展,形成统一的故障数据库和维修标准,推动整个行业的技术进步。智能诊断技术的进步将与自动驾驶技术深度融合,确保车辆运行的安全性和可靠性,从而降低维修成本提高用户满意度,促进新能源汽车产业的可持续发展。 With the popularization of new energy vehicles,traditional inspection and maintenance methods can no longer meet the needs of complex electrical systems and highly integrated electronic control devices.Through the application of artificial intelligence,big data and Internet of Things technology,intelligent diagnosis technology provides more accurate fault prediction and real-time monitoring,significantly improving the efficiency and accuracy of inspection and maintenance.Through data sharing and collaborative development,this paper forms a unified fault database and maintenance standards,and promotes the technological progress of the entire industry.The advancement of intelligent diagnosis technology will be deeply integrated with autonomous driving technology to ensure the safety and reliability of vehicle operation,thereby reducing maintenance costs,improving user satisfaction,and promoting the sustainable development of the new energy vehicle industry.
